Study Summary

The purpose of this study will be to examine the efficacy, safety, and tolerability of ruxolitinib cream in subjects with vitiligo.

Primary Outcome

An F-VASI50 responder achieved at least 50% improvement from Baseline in F-VASI, measured by the percentage of vitiligo involvement (percentage of body surface area \[BSA\]) and the degree of depigmentation: 0% (no depigmentation), 10% (only specks of depigmentation), 25% (pigmented area exceeded depigmented area), 50% (depigmented and pigmented area was equal), 75% (depigmented area exceeded pigmented area), 90% (specks of pigment), or 100% (no pigment). Frequently Asked Questions

What is clinical trial NCT03099304 about?

NCT03099304 is a clinical study titled "A Study of INCB018424 Phosphate Cream in Subjects With Vitiligo". The purpose of this study will be to examine the efficacy, safety, and tolerability of ruxolitinib cream in subjects with vitiligo.

What is the current status of trial NCT03099304?

This trial is currently completed. It is a Phase 2 study. The enrollment target is 157 participants. The study started on 2017-06-07. Estimated completion is 2021-09-08.

What conditions does trial NCT03099304 study?

This clinical trial studies the following conditions: Vitiligo.

What interventions are being tested in trial NCT03099304?

The interventions under investigation include: Vehicle cream (DRUG), Ruxolitinib cream (DRUG).
